Output 63020b300f0cd1f901a96d5d7287e2045d16d7923990bbcb3c8d5d501afd52ff:1

value
14662453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7c5e34fade188efd29bf5434d7267f471abf35 OP_EQUAL
address
3JnMGezfWjpSqLf8hb6JHKnE3ZMmybNBpg
transaction
63020b300f0cd1f901a96d5d7287e2045d16d7923990bbcb3c8d5d501afd52ff
confirmations
530054
spent
true